This pre-solicitation notice serves as a synopsis and is posted in accordance with FAR subpart 5.2, Synopses of Proposed Contract Actions. This is not a solicitation. Vendors shall not submit a quote until the solicitation is posted to www.SAM.gov. The Department of War Education Activity (DoWEA) has the following requirements: The Contractor shall provide commercial off-the-shelf, 100% digital courseware for students and teachers as well as related professional learning, and technical support for One course: Video Communications I. The instructional resources shall be based on research-based best practices shown to help students master the standards.
Background The Department of Defense Education Activity (DoDEA) is a federally operated school system that manages educational programs for approximately 66,000 children of active-duty military and DoD civilian families across 161 accredited schools. The agency aims to provide high-quality education that meets College and Career Ready Standards. DoDEA has offered the Video Communications Pathway for over a decade, with the most recent contract awarded in fiscal year 2021. This contract must be recompeted according to federal regulations. Work Details The Contractor shall provide commercial off-the-shelf, 100% digital courseware for students and teachers, specifically for the Video Communications I course. The instructional resources must be based on research-based best practices to help students master the standards. Key tasks include: 1. Instructional Resources: - Provide student resources that include various instructional activities enabling mastery of video communication concepts such as media roles, writing for broadcast, shot composition, production planning, equipment use, safety on set, and video editing. - Provide teacher resources including lesson plans, tests/quizzes, project ideas, technical support materials, and training resources. - Ensure alignment with DoDEA’s adopted standards and competencies as well as ACA Premiere Pro exam objectives. - Develop a comprehensive scope and sequence for the courseware. 2. Product Training: - Deliver asynchronous webinars or SCORM-compliant modules to train users on navigating the materials. 3. Technical Support: - Provide industry-standard technical support via phone or email within one business day for any issues related to digital resources. Period of Performance The period of performance is anticipated to be a five-year base period from June 24, 2026, to June 23, 2031. Place of Performance Work shall be performed at the Contractor’s facilities.
